What is an MBA in Entrepreneurship (Distance / Online)?
An MBA in Entrepreneurship (Distance / Online) is a postgraduate management program designed to equip individuals with the knowledge and skills required to launch, manage, and grow new ventures or innovate within existing organizations. Unlike traditional full-time programs, distance or online formats deliver the curriculum through virtual platforms, self-study materials, and occasional contact classes, offering significant flexibility.
This program typically covers core business functions like finance, marketing, operations, and human resources, but with a strong emphasis on entrepreneurial concepts such as ideation, business plan development, venture capital, innovation management, and scaling strategies. It’s ideal for those looking to start their own business, join a startup, or drive entrepreneurial initiatives in corporate settings.
What is the eligibility for MBA in Entrepreneurship Distance / Online in India?
The eligibility criteria for an MBA in Entrepreneurship Distance / Online in India generally require a bachelor’s degree from a recognized university, often with a minimum aggregate score, and sometimes relevant work experience.
Most institutions require candidates to hold a bachelor’s degree (10+2+3 or 10+2+4 format) in any discipline from a recognized university, with a minimum aggregate percentage typically ranging from 45% to 50%. While some programs are open to fresh graduates, many prefer or even mandate 1-3 years of work experience, especially for executive online MBA variants. English language proficiency is also a common requirement. Some universities may conduct their own entrance tests or accept scores from national-level MBA entrance exams like CAT, MAT, XAT, CMAT, or ATMA, though direct admission based on graduation marks is also common for distance learning.
How much does MBA in Entrepreneurship Distance / Online cost in India?
The cost of an MBA in Entrepreneurship Distance / Online in India varies significantly, ranging from approximately ₹50,000 to ₹4,00,000 for the entire program, depending on the institution’s reputation, faculty, and infrastructure.
Government-affiliated or state university distance learning departments typically offer more affordable programs, often in the range of ₹50,000 to ₹1,50,000. Private universities and specialized online learning platforms, which might offer more interactive sessions, advanced learning management systems, and industry-specific mentorship, can charge between ₹1,50,000 and ₹4,00,000. These fees usually cover tuition, study materials, and access to online resources, but may not include examination fees or optional workshops.
Typical Fee Ranges for MBA in Entrepreneurship (Distance / Online)
| Institution Type | Approximate Total Fees (INR) | Key Features |
|---|---|---|
| Government/State University (Distance) | ₹50,000 – ₹1,50,000 | Affordable, recognized degrees, self-study focused |
| Private University (Online/Distance) | ₹1,50,000 – ₹3,00,000 | Better LMS, some live sessions, industry connect |
| Specialized Online Platforms/Ed-Tech | ₹2,50,000 – ₹4,00,000 | Advanced curriculum, mentorship, career services |

What is the syllabus and subjects covered in an MBA in Entrepreneurship Distance / Online?
The syllabus for an MBA in Entrepreneurship Distance / Online typically covers core management subjects in the first year and specialized entrepreneurship modules in the second, focusing on practical application and venture creation.
While specific curricula may vary, common subjects include:
- Core Management Subjects: Marketing Management, Financial Management, Human Resource Management, Operations Management, Business Economics, Business Statistics, Organizational Behavior, Business Law, Research Methodology.
- Entrepreneurship Specialization Subjects:
- Introduction to Entrepreneurship & New Venture Creation
- Business Plan Development & Feasibility Analysis
- Entrepreneurial Finance & Venture Capital
- Innovation Management & Design Thinking
- Marketing for Startups
- Legal Aspects of Entrepreneurship
- Family Business Management (optional)
- Social Entrepreneurship (optional)
- Scaling & Growth Strategies
- Digital Entrepreneurship
- Project Management for Entrepreneurs
- Many programs also include a project work, dissertation, or business plan submission as a capstone requirement.
How long does it take to complete an MBA in Entrepreneurship Distance / Online?
An MBA in Entrepreneurship Distance / Online in India typically takes 2 years to complete, similar to a full-time MBA. However, some flexible distance learning programs may allow students to extend the duration up to 3-5 years.
The standard duration is two academic years, divided into four semesters. This allows for comprehensive coverage of both core management principles and specialized entrepreneurial topics. The flexibility of online/distance learning often means students can manage their study pace, but most institutions set a maximum completion period to ensure timely graduation and curriculum relevance.

What is the difference between an online MBA and a distance MBA?
While often used interchangeably, ‘online MBA’ typically implies a more technology-driven, interactive learning experience with live virtual classes, discussion forums, and a robust Learning Management System (LMS). ‘Distance MBA’ can be broader, sometimes involving more self-study materials, recorded lectures, and fewer live interactions, though modern distance programs increasingly incorporate online elements.
